Wrong DNS Name on Win2000 install

by bmyers . Updated 24 years, 4 months ago

OOPS! I made the mistake of using my registered internet name as the domain name for my new Win2000 PDC upgrade. This is an internally numbered network and our DNS is handled by ISP. I know this can work if you monkey with DNS zones, etc, but I wantto start over and have a different domain name for the internal network.

Can I remove Active Directory from this domain controller and reinstall AD and still pickup my user accounts, etc.? As it stands now, I have the upgraded PDC and a BDC. Thatis all I have for DC’s.

What would be the best course of action for me. I can’t be the only one that has made this mistake.
